JOB DESCRIPTION:

This is a full-time probationary/permanent position. This position is responsible for the total process of : detection, prevention, investigation, compiling of evidence, computation of the over-payments, initiation of the recovery action, (court or otherwise) and the collection and tracking of over-payments, in all cases of fraud and abuse, or other over-payments, in the public assistance cases administered in the Income Maintenance Section of the department. The employee must explain program requirements and options and refer clients to other program services as appropriate.

K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, ABILITIES:

This position requires a through working knowledge of all Income Maintenance programs administered by the department, and a general knowledge of all social services programs. The position requires through knowledge of the use of manuals and other policies used in administering the Income Maintenance Programs and knowledge of the investigative procedures and techniques of the judicial system. The position requires a thorough knowledge of the computer programs used in administering the Income Maintenance Programs. The person in this position must be skilled in communication and able to effectively communicate with staff, clientele, courtroom personnel, and law enforcement as well as other people in the community to collect necessary evidence and support actions taken. The position must be able to make written and verbal reports relating to their findings in investigations, as required by the department, the courts, the state, and others. The position must be able to work independently with minimal supervision, as well as being able to work with staff, law enforcement, the court system, other departments, and the general public, in properly establishing claims and collecting over-payments, to maintain the integrity of the departments programs. This position requires the person to have a valid NC Drivers license and a verified excellent driving record. The person in this position must be mobile and able to travel in completing investigations in various, and sometimes risky, locations, and be able to attend any necessary training. The person in this position must be able to provide a clean criminal history report.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ATION:

An Associate Degree in Human Services Technology, Social Services Associate, Paralegal Technology, Criminal Justice, Business Administration, Secretarial Science or a closely related curriculum and two years of experiences as an Income Maintenance Caseworker or Investigator; or, graduation from high school and three years of experience as an Income Maintenance Caseworker or Income Maintenance Investigator; or graduation from high school and two years of investigative experience in credit , legal, or law enforcement work plus eighteen months of experience as an Income Maintenance Caseworker or Income Maintenance Investigator; or an equivalent combination of training and experience.
